In what cases can a worker be fired for just cause in Peru?

A worker can be fired for just cause in cases of serious misconduct established by law, such as theft, violence or serious disobedience to the employer's orders.

What is the process to request a review of alimony in Argentina?

The process to request a review of child support in Argentina generally begins by submitting an application to the family court. This request must include updated documentation supporting changes in financial or family situation that warrant review. Subsequently, a hearing will be held where both parties will present their arguments and evidence. The court will evaluate the request and issue a decision based on equity and the welfare of the beneficiaries. It is essential to follow established legal procedures to ensure a fair review.

What are the legal implications of the crime of statutory rape in Colombia?

The crime of statutory rape in Colombia refers to the sexual relationship or sexual act with a minor, but over the age of consent, through deception, abuse of trust or taking advantage of their inexperience. Legal implications may include criminal legal actions, prison sentences, fines, protection and support measures for minor victims, and additional actions for violation of the sexual rights and integrity of minors.

What is the role of the National Minors Service in background checks for workers who interact with minors in Chile?

The National Service for Minors (SENAME) in Chile has an important role in background checks for workers who interact with minors. Employers may require criminal records and certificates of non-disqualification from SENAME to guarantee the suitability of candidates who will work with minors. The safety and well-being of minors are priorities in this area.
